How can companies measure the success of their internal communication strategies in terms of customer loyalty and brand advocacy, and what key metrics should they be tracking to ensure effectiveness?

Companies can measure the success of their internal communication strategies in terms of customer loyalty and brand advocacy by tracking key metrics such as employee engagement levels, customer satisfaction scores, Net Promoter Score (NPS), and social media sentiment analysis. By monitoring these metrics, companies can gauge the impact of their internal communication efforts on customer perceptions and loyalty. Additionally, tracking metrics related to employee advocacy and participation in brand initiatives can also provide insights into the effectiveness of internal communication strategies in driving brand advocacy and customer loyalty.
